| | > Right now, exit.php?www.google.com becomes
> exit1234.html?www.google.com and
> exit.php?www.bing.com becomes
> exit3456.html?www.bing.com
>
> Is there a way to disable the creation of individual
> copies of exit.html, while keeping the
> queries-strings in the calling links?
No - you may want to filter out the page, however (Options / Scan Rules / and
add: -*exit.php?*)
